Family and Community Health (FCH) is part of the Texas A&M AgriLife Extension Service, Texas A&M System. We offer practical health information for families from; raising children, housing and environment, eating well, managing money, and staying healthy.

Breckenridge High School seniors got a glimpse of their future during the “It’s Your Money!” program on Thursday, March 26, sponsored by Texas A&M AgriLife Extension and InterBank, in partnership with the high school.

❄️ Preparedness Matters — Especially in Winter & Emergencies ❄️

Being prepared can make all the difference during winter weather and unexpected disasters. From power outages and severe cold to emergencies that limit travel or access to resources, having a plan in place helps keep individuals and families safe, calm, and confident.

We are excited to welcome a Specialist from DAR to Stephens County to educate our Healthy Aging class on:
• Winter weather preparedness
• Emergency and disaster planning
• Staying safe during power outages
• Medication, nutrition, and health considerations during emergencies
• Simple steps to be ready before an emergency happens

This educational opportunity is especially important for older adults, as preparation supports independence, safety, and peace of mind during challenging situations.

We’re grateful for the partnership and for providing valuable resources that help our community stay informed, prepared, and resilient.

We’re excited to have welcomed Watch UR BAC to BJHS! This powerful, student-focused program is designed to educate and empower students to make safe, responsible choices—especially when it comes to driving, decision-making, and peer influence.

🚗 What is Watch UR BAC?
Watch UR BAC is a nationally recognized program that promotes:
• Teen driver safety
• Smart decision-making
• Accountability and leadership
• Awareness of consequences and real-life scenarios

Through engaging discussions and real-world examples, students learn how their choices impact not only themselves, but their friends, families, and community.

We’re grateful to bring this opportunity to our students and help reinforce important life skills that extend beyond the classroom.
